Output 8f15262587ecfc93ec3316742d8f217d4ed1826200a732a2cb633e71bcc2fa1c:12

value
1196763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572e28fda43c5314d24447ad73d49741bcf0359b OP_EQUAL
address
39dz1VdMm9mRY64vrKmq53s4ZBjbk1M3HG
transaction
8f15262587ecfc93ec3316742d8f217d4ed1826200a732a2cb633e71bcc2fa1c
spent
true